Rawalpindi: Rawalpindi Police have intensified operations against kite suppliers, arresting five individuals and seizing hundreds of kites and kite strings from their possession here on Sunday.
The raids were conducted in Civil Lines and Dhamiyal police jurisdictions, and separate cases have been registered against each of the suspects. Police spokesperson said that kite flying a non-bailable offense due to the serious risks involved in it.
City Police Officer CPO Syed Khalid Mahmood Hamdani warned that individuals involved in this dangerous and deadly activity will not escape the law, reaffirming Rawalpindi Police’s commitment to public safety and strict enforcement against illegal kite flying.
